Comprehending the Acne-Stress Connection
When you experience tension, it's greater than simply a psychological problem; it can additionally cause physical responses that impact your skin. This link in between stress and anxiety and acne is significant, as anxiety boosts the production of cortisol, a hormone that can lead to enhanced oil manufacturing in your skin.
When your skin becomes oilier, it can clog pores, creating an excellent environment for acne to create. Furthermore, tension can trigger inflammation in your body, which might aggravate existing acne or lead to new outbreaks.
You could notice that throughout particularly stressful times, your skin responds with more redness, inflammation, or breakouts than normal. It's not simply hormone modifications at play; tension can likewise influence your skin care regimen.
You may find yourself neglecting your common regimen or participating in undesirable practices, like touching your face more frequently or missing cleansing. Acknowledging this connection is critical.
Efficient Stress And Anxiety Administration Strategies
Handling tension successfully can considerably boost your skin's wellness and overall health. Beginning by incorporating regular exercise into your regimen. Exercise launches endorphins, which help reduce stress and anxiety and boost your mood. Aim for at least thirty minutes of moderate workout most days of the week.
Next off, practice mindfulness strategies like reflection or deep-breathing workouts. Taking just a couple of mins every day to concentrate on your breath can aid calm your mind and reduce anxiety. You can also try journaling; listing your ideas can provide clearness and help you refine emotions.
Do not ignore the power of social support. Make time to connect with family and friends that boost you. Sharing your feelings can lighten your psychological lots and enhance your bonds.

Skincare Tips for Outbreak Avoidance
A solid skincare routine can make a significant difference in avoiding outbreaks. Here are some necessary tips to help you preserve clear skin and minimize the probability of outbreaks:
- ** Cleanse Twice Day-to-day **: Make use of a gentle cleanser in the morning and night to remove excess oil, dust, and contaminations. This helps maintain your pores clear and reduces the possibilities of acne.
- ** Hydrate **: Don't avoid this step! Even if you have oily skin, a lightweight, non-comedogenic cream can maintain your skin hydrated. Hydration is key to maintaining a healthy skin barrier.
- ** Area Therapy **: Use a targeted therapy including components like sal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ide on any kind of emerging acnes. This can help reduce inflammation and speed up healing.
Furthermore, take into consideration using items with comforting ingredients like aloe vera or chamomile, especially throughout demanding times.
Bear in mind to avoid touching your face and change your pillowcases regularly.
